    I've played NHL games 94-99, 2000-2002 and 2004. So far my favorite NHL game is NHL 2001. I thought that one improved quite a lot from NHL 2000 and was fun to play. In NHL 2002, the goals were way too luck-based, I never played NHL 2003 since I heard it was quite bad and I didn't like NHL 2004's system at all (in the PC version). I haven't really played any NHL games after that.
